Splendorous Djinn re-mastered with new pieces now released

Making a return to Alternative Armies a mighty creature in our fantasy ranges.  The Djinn has been re-mastered and transformed into a multiple part kit with a small degree of posing and two different choices of weapons included.

VNT32 The Spendorous Djinn
This code contains ONE metal model approx 55mm in height which can be assembled in two different ways and has two different weapon hands included.   Works in several scales as a giant or god or foe. A Large Djinn (Genie) kit composed of one body with a separate head, separate fist hand and two different weapon hands ( trident and magical staff).  Assemble your chosen version and use other weapon hand for diorama or scenics.  Small degree of wrist and neck pose choice. This model is not supplied with a base and is supplied unpainted.  Images show variants and scale shot (other miniatures not included).  Go HERE.


As you can see above this creature works well in 28mm scale and in 15mm scale too.
